DETROIT 13 October: Call To Holiness Conference

Those of you anywhere near Detroit will be glad to know that the 14th Call To Holiness Conference will be held on Saturday, 13 October.  Lot’s of information about the conference HERE. Today is the last day (until midnight EST) to register online, HERE.  Tickets can be purchased at the door, however.

Among those involved are:

Bp. Alex Sample – Bishop of Marquette
Fr. John Trigilio – author and EWTN
Fr. Frank Philips – St. John Cantius, Chicago
Fr. Brian Harrison – author, teacher
Dr. Monica Miller – teacher, pro-life activist
Mr. Louie Verrecchio – author, publisher
and the undersigned.

The Divine Liturgy will be celebrated for the conference at St. Josaphat Ukrainian Catholic Church and, on Sunday at noon, Bp. Sample will celebrate a Pontifical Mass in the Extraordinary Form at the famous Assumption Grotto.
